Bus station hiking trails around Judenau-Baumgarten offer access to the diverse landscapes of Lower Austria's Tullnerfeld region. The area transitions from the flat plains of the Tullnerfeld into the foothills of the Vienna Woods, providing varied terrain for hikers. This geographical position results in a mix of rolling hills, dense forests, and open meadows. Elevations like the Auberg and Baumgartner Berg provide viewpoints across the Tullnerfeld and towards the Danube River.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many bus-accessible hiking trails are available around Judenau-Baumgarten?

There are over 25 bus-accessible hiking routes in the Judenau-Baumgarten area, offering a variety of experiences for different skill levels. These trails allow you to explore the diverse landscapes of the Tullnerfeld and the foothills of the Vienna Woods.

What is the general difficulty and terrain like for bus station hikes in Judenau-Baumgarten?

The bus-accessible hikes around Judenau-Baumgarten primarily feature easy to moderate difficulty levels. You'll find routes traversing rolling hills, dense forests, verdant meadows, and some gentle ascents into the Vienna Woods foothills. The terrain is generally well-suited for a relaxed outdoor experience, with 11 easy and 17 moderate routes available.

Are there any family-friendly hiking options accessible by bus in Judenau-Baumgarten?

Yes, Judenau-Baumgarten offers several family-friendly hiking options. The region is known for its relaxed and well-marked trails suitable for various skill levels, including those with children. A notable option is the Judenau Nature Trail, an educational 3-kilometer path with stations providing information on local flora, fauna, and history, perfect for engaging younger hikers.

What are the best times of year to go hiking from a bus station in Judenau-Baumgarten?

The best seasons for hiking in Judenau-Baumgarten are spring and autumn. During these times, nature flourishes with vibrant colors or displays warm hues, and temperatures are pleasantly mild for outdoor activities. Summer can also be enjoyable, especially in the shaded forest sections, while winter might offer different scenic beauty, though some paths could be less accessible depending on snow conditions.

Can I bring my dog on the bus-accessible hiking trails in Judenau-Baumgarten?

Many trails in the Judenau-Baumgarten region are suitable for hiking with dogs. It's generally recommended to keep dogs on a leash, especially in agricultural areas, near wildlife, or when passing through villages. Always ensure you carry water for your dog and clean up after them to maintain the natural environment for everyone.

Are there any circular hiking routes that start from a bus station in Judenau-Baumgarten?

Yes, there are several circular routes accessible from bus stations. For example, the Picture oaks loop from Judenau-Baumgarten is an easy 4.1 km circular hike. Another option is the Wayside Shrine with Rest Area loop from Judenau-Baumgarten, which is a moderate 8.2 km circular route.

What kind of views or natural features can I expect on these bus-accessible hikes?

The region offers diverse and picturesque landscapes. From the foothills of the Vienna Woods, you can expect rolling hills and dense forests. The Auberg provides expansive views across the Tullnerfeld, along the Danube River, and towards the Wagram region. The Baumgartner Berg also rewards hikers with spectacular panoramic views of the surrounding countryside, including forests, meadows, pastures, and vineyards.

Are there any points of interest or attractions near the bus station hiking trails?

Yes, the area offers several points of interest. You might encounter historic cellar alleys, particularly in Baumgarten and Judenau, which are unique cultural elements. While hiking, you could also spot the stately Judenau Castle or various churches and monuments like the Way of the Cross on the Auberg. For a different kind of attraction, the Fairy Tale Forest Chapel and Pond is a charming highlight.

Can I find places to eat or drink near the bus station hiking trails?

Yes, along the hiking and cycling routes in Judenau-Baumgarten, you'll find several inns, traditional taverns, and wine taverns (Heurige). These establishments invite visitors to take a break and enjoy local cuisine and homegrown wines, making for a pleasant stop during or after your hike.
